Responsibilities

  • Assists in evaluating referrals for admission to the home health program.
  • Assists in identifying patients who would benefit from services.
  • Acts as a resource person to hospital social service departments, nursing personnel, and discharge planners to evaluate referrals as appropriate.
  • Assists in investigating the patient’s financial situation as appropriate.
  • Assists in identifying patients’ needs and in formulating an initial plan of care for those patients admitted into the Agency’s service.
  • Affords social determinants of health assessments.
  • Explores available community resources that might be helpful in meeting the patients’ needs.
  • Explores available community resources and assists patient in qualifying for eligible programs.
  • Affords assistance to patients in utilizing or building support systems.
  • Affords assistance to patients and their families in dealing with the emotional aspects of their illnesses and conditions.
  • Affords assistance to patients and their families in accepting their medical condition and complying with medical recommendations.
  • Affords assistance to patients in formulating Advance Directives.
  • Participates in multi-disciplinary team meetings.
  • Reevaluates goals and plans of care and offers suggestions to meet patients’ needs in a better way.
  • Affords assistance to health team members with emotional factors related to patients’ health problems.
  • Affords assistance to health team members in planning patient care and offers suggestions as appropriate.
  • Maintains required medical records.
  • Documents observations made, and actions taken in a timely fashion using paper or electronic means.
  • Documents patients’ progress or response to care as appropriate using paper or electronic means.
  • Keeps physicians informed of patients’ progress.
  • Discusses patients with physicians when appropriate to clarify goals and objectives and to clarify the plan of care.

Qualifications

  • Holds Master’s degree from school of social work accredited by the Council on Social Work Education.
  • Holds LSW or LCSW licensure.
  • Holds minimum of one-year experience as a social worker in a hospital, out-patient, nursing home, or home care setting.
  • Holds a thorough knowledge of community resources.
  • Holds good communication skills.
  • Able to deal effectively with stressful situations and a fast-paced environment.
